The Starting Point: Hotel Pickup and Journey to Koprulu Canyon
We begin early, with pickup from your hotel—an unmissable convenience that saves you from navigating unfamiliar roads. The drive out of Antalya offers a glimpse of the Turkish countryside before you arrive at the Koprulu Canyon National Park, a haven for nature lovers and adventure seekers alike. The park’s crystal-clear waters and rugged canyon walls set a stunning scene for the day’s activities.
This initial stop lasts about 2 hours, giving you enough time to get a feel for the area and perhaps snap a few photos before the adrenaline kicks in. It’s also where you’ll meet your guides, who are generally praised for their energy and friendliness.
The Heart of the Tour: Koprulu Canyon Rafting
The highlight for many is the rafting experience in the roaring waters of the Koprulu River. This activity alone takes about 6 hours, and we can’t overstate how much fun it is. The river’s rapids are challenging enough to get your pulse pounding but manageable for beginners, making it accessible for most.
Participants work together to steer the raft through twisting, splashing rapids—an excellent team activity. The guides are skilled at keeping everyone safe while making sure you’re having a blast. One reviewer, Farkhanda, praised how their guide Ahmed kept the energy high and made the trip especially memorable. Expect to get wet, so pack a change of clothes and a waterproof camera if you want to document your adventure.

What’s Included and What’s Not
Your booking covers all the essentials: hotel pick-up and drop-off, helmet, life jacket, paddles, and lunch—a hearty meal to refuel after a morning of physical activity. Additional expenses, such as photos and videos or drinks, are optional and not included.

FAQ
Is hotel pickup included in the tour?
Yes, the tour includes hotel pickup and drop-off, making it very convenient. You’ll be collected early, around 8:30 am.
What activities are part of the tour?
The tour features white-water rafting, and if you choose, a jeep safari, quad biking, buggy rides, and ziplining—all designed to boost your adrenaline.
How long does the entire tour last?
Approximately 10 hours, from pickup in the morning to return in the late afternoon or early evening.
Do I need prior experience for the activities?
No prior experience is necessary. The activities are suitable for beginners and are supervised by guides.
What should I bring?
Wear comfortable, quick-drying clothes, bring a change of clothes, and consider a waterproof camera. All safety equipment is provided.
Is the tour suitable for children?
It is suitable for people of all ages, but note the physical nature of some activities—moderate fitness is recommended.
Are there any additional costs?
Photo and video services are optional and not included. Drinks are also not included, so you might want to bring some cash for refreshments.
Can I cancel the tour?
Yes, the tour offers free cancellation up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und.
